#1dbe28 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dbe28 is composed of 11.4% red, 74.5%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 78.9%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 124.1 degrees, a saturation of 73.5% and a lightness of 42.9%. #1dbe28 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ff50 with #007d00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1dbe28
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000301 is the darkest color, while #f1fdf2 is the lightest one.
